Injury reports for Patriots, Broncos largely unchanged from Wednesday

On Wednesday, the Patriots listed 20 players on their injury report.

That number grew to 21 on Thursday, although it wasn’t an addition that should cause much concern leading up to Sunday’s game against the Broncos. Safety Patrick Chung was listed as a full participant in practice with a foot injury after not being listed at all for Wednesday’s practice.

The only other change for the Patriots on Thursday was that special teams captain Matthew Slater was a limited participant with a shin injury. Slater didn’t practice at all on Wednesday and his return means that all 53 players on the active roster took part in Thursday’s session. Fifteen of them were limited and many of those players will likely draw questionable tags on Friday’s final injury report of the week.

All eleven Broncos on Wednesday’s injury report were full participants and that was the case again on Thursday. That number includes cornerback Chris Harris, who General Manager John Elway said will be a game-time decision due to his shoulder injury.
